Enroll Course: https://www.coursera.org/learn/object-oriented-python
Si vous êtes un novice en programmation ou si vous cherchez à solidifier vos compétences en Python, le cours Object-Oriented Python: Inheritance and Encapsulation sur Coursera pourrait être exactement ce dont vous avez besoin. Conçu pour ceux qui n’ont que peu d’expérience en codage, ce cours vous offre une introduction pratique à la programmation orientée objet en Python.
Le cours commence par vous faire écrire et exécuter votre premier programme Python en quelques minutes, sans nécessiter d’installation préalable, ce qui est un avantage majeur pour les débutants. En outre, le cours couvre des concepts fondamentaux de l’informatique qui peuvent être appliqués à d’autres langages de programmation, renforçant ainsi votre compréhension générale de la programmation.
Voici un aperçu des modules du cours :
- Héritage : Dans cette première semaine, vous apprendrez à réutiliser le code d’une classe dans une autre grâce à des relations d’héritage. Les exercices pratiques et les laboratoires vous permettront d’appliquer vos nouvelles connaissances directement.
- Encapsulation : La deuxième semaine se concentre sur l’encapsulation, qui consiste à regrouper des méthodes et des données liées à un objet au sein de sa classe. Comme précédemment, des laboratoires et des exercices notés vous aideront à comprendre ce concept essentiel.
- Polymorphisme : La troisième semaine aborde le polymorphisme, qui ajoute de la flexibilité à vos méthodes grâce à des techniques de surcharge et de redéfinition. Attendez-vous à mettre en pratique ce que vous apprenez à travers des exercices pratiques.
- Sujets avancés : Dans la dernière semaine, vous explorerez d’autres sujets concernant les classes et les objets, tels que le stockage d’objets dans des fichiers individuels et la création d’une liste d’objets. Cette semaine se conclura également par des laboratoires et des exercices notés.
En somme, ce cours vous offre non seulement des bases solides sur Python, mais vous familiarisera également avec des concepts essentiels de la programmation orientée objet. Je recommande vivement ce cours à quiconque souhaite entrer dans le monde de la programmation. Si vous n’avez pas encore suivi les trois cours précédents de cette spécialisation, il peut être utile de le faire pour tirer le meilleur parti de ce cours.
Plongez-vous dans la programmation Python et préparez-vous à devenir un développeur accompli!
Enroll Course: https://www.coursera.org/learn/object-oriented-python